About This Property

This semi-detached house is located in DERBY, DE23 2NU. The property offers 52mยฒ (560 sq ft) of modest-sized living space with 3 habitable rooms. It is a post-war property from the mid-20th century. With an EPC rating of D (65/100), this property is around the UK average for energy efficiency. With recommended improvements, it could achieve a B rating (88/100). The gas central heating system has good efficiency, indicating a relatively modern, well-maintained boiler. The walls feature cavity wall insulation for improved thermal efficiency. Double glazing is installed, though the efficiency rating suggests older units. Modern low-E double glazing can be up to 40% more efficient than units installed before 2002. Estimated annual energy costs are ยฃ866, comprising ยฃ686 for heating, ยฃ115 for hot water, and ยฃ65 for lighting. The property produces 2.7 tonnes of CO2 per year, which is low for a UK home. What do these speeds mean? 10-30 Mbps: Good for browsing and streaming. 30-100 Mbps: Great for multiple users and HD streaming. 100-300 Mbps: Excellent for 4K streaming and gaming. 300+ Mbps: Perfect for large households and heavy internet use.
